Subject: Re: [PATCH v2 1/7] drm/i915: Add more dev ops for MIPI sub encoder
Date: Fri, 15 Nov 2013 10:29:03 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<87ob5mgjao.fsf@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1383990548-30737-2-git-send-email-shobhit.kumar@intel.com>
On Sat, 09 Nov 2013, Shobhit Kumar <shobhit.kumar@intel.com> wrote:
> Some panels require one time programming if they do not contain their
> own eeprom for basic register initialization. The sequence is
>
> Panel Reset --> Send OTP --> Enable Pixel Stream --> Enable the panel
>
